Lagos Police Shuts Down Cubana Over COVID-19 Rules, ‘Arrests Clubbers’ (Video)

Cubana night club has been shut down by the Lagos Police for defying COVID-19 directive.
The Lagos State Commission for safety just sealed off Cubana Ikeja and other facilities for non compliance to the state COVID-19 protocol, OnyxNews Nigeria reports.
This online news platform reports that the development was disclosed in a statement issued on the micro-blogging site, Twitter by Gboyega Akosile, the Chief Press Secretary to the governor of Lagos Statement, Babajide Sanwo-Olu.
“Just in: @followlasg @lagossafety and @PoliceNG Lagos State Command sealed off Cubana night club for disobeying the State’s #COVID19 protocols,” the statement read.
Though it is unclear if the clubbers at Cubana night club were arrested, however, some videos published on the micro-blogging site, Twitter by netizens, show police officers of the Lagos Police Command refusing to allow clubbers willingly leave the night club premises.

But, the arrest is coming barely a day after Governor Sanwo-Olu re-imposed COVID-19 restrictions in Lagos State, where he noted that concerts, carnivals and street parties are banned in Lagos State indefinitely, just as night clubs have not been allowed to open yet, noting that “all night clubs in Lagos must immediately shut down, until further notice.”
